--LOOKS // [/b]He's handsome, there's no denying that. Taro's overall fur color is gold, though when it grows out in winter it appears to be more orangeish. His muzzle is white, and he has a patch of white on his chest. His only other marking is one white back paw. It's true that his fur isn't just one color; it's comprised of many shades that alternately become lighte and darker in various places on his body. (Such as his nape and head, which are slightly lighter colors than the rest of his body.) Taro's pelt hue is nothing special, just a normal forest cat. However, if you look closely you can see some faint stripes breaking the fur. That's the pattern which makes him a tabby, although it's mostly only apparent on his tail; the rest of him appears to be solid-colored.
The texture of his fur is thick and shaggy. He's not long-haired and heavy; just a medium length, but still rather disheveled. Taro thinks it's his trademark to appear to be messy-haired. It gives him a certain boyish charm, to add to his already charming personality. Taro's fur provides good protection in battle; long hair acts like armor on a cat. Which is the reason that a lot of his scars are hidden, though some still stick it. The most prominent one is a large zig-zag on his chest. A badger had ripped his chest open once and nearly killed him; the scar is still hairless. The pink flesh exposed there isn't as tender as it used to be, but it's his major weakness. If a cat bites into there, blood will start gushing uncontrollably since it's unprotected. That's why he's developed several fighting maneuvers to keep his chest hidden in battle.
--PERSONALITY // [/b]Taro is one chill cat. He is unbelievably free-spirited and takes what life throws at him with a laid-back demeanor, as if challenging the world. Although he's not clueless, and in fact very learned of the world, Taro still thinks life is a wonderful adventure. He hates the predictability of Clan life, which is why he left. You could probably say Taro's an adrenaline junkie: he loves the rush that comes with not knowing what'll happen next. He travels with a longing for excitement and challenges. The tom likes to flirt a lot, especially with Clan she-cats, since he knows they're prudish and don't warm up to cats outside their Clan. In a nutshell, he loves to tease she-cats just to see their reactions. Then again, what normal tom wouldn't? (Well, unless he was a Clan tom. Then he'd be too focused on finding a she-cat to, er, reproduce with and wowing her with all that romantic nonsense and whatnot. When really they just want to get with her.) You could think of Taro as a human teenager almost, a bundle of hormones. He doesn't believe in true love and won't be looking for it anytime soon. For this reason, although some she-cats might feel privileged by the attention he pays them, he doesn't care if he breaks a heart or two. After all, it's just a game to him, and he expects the other players to know that as well. (Taro's the kind to have a one-night stand and leave. So, ladies, if you're looking for a soulmate, you might want to skip this player.)
Taro is a blithe wastrel; he's unconcerned with wasting resources. In leaf-bare, prey is always scarce. So if he hunts something on Clan territory, kittypet territory, or another loner's territory, he'll take it even though it's technically not his. He won't give two fox-dungs about how less prey will affect the cat(s) he took it from; Taro will do whatever he can to survive. Even if it's at the expense of another cat's life. He likes life, and he plans to enjoy it to its fullest. He doesn't care about warrior codes and honor; maybe because he doesn't have any. The tom isn't low enough that he would sacrifice say, a pregnant she-cat or something to save himself -- he still has a sense of valor -- but he's not about to place himself in mortal danger for a strange cat he doesn't know. Taro is pretty intelligent; how else would he have been able to survive for so long? He knows that if a cat is fighting off a pack of foxes, then it's their own fault for wandering into a fox den, and they have to suffer the consequences of their stupidity. Brutal, but true, is it not?
Aside from that, Taro is still somewhat loyal to his family. He was born with a very nonchalant personality; nothing seems to faze him, nothing seems to surprise him. He left the Clans for no other reason than he was looking for a little more adventure. Some cats may think that's a stupid choice, and may be frustrated with his non-caring personality. But that's just the way Taro is. Maybe one day, if he ever cares about a cat enough (fall in love?) to be with them for more than a day at a time, he'll change and become more responsive. Until then, well, Taro's just a laid-back, reserved little cat.
